We are recruiting for a Quantity Surveyor (QS) to join us here at Octavius, supporting schemes in Somerset. Octavius are a leading civil engineering organisation delivering safe, sustainable, and efficient transport solutions across the UK. In this role, visibility on site is essential. Therefore, the successful candidate will be required to be full time on site.
Responsibilities
- You will be responsible for the robust commercial management of projects. This includes overseeing financial performance, managing costs, conducting procurement processes, and maintaining accurate financial logs and reports.
- You will work closely with customers and stakeholders to support successful project delivery, ensuring compliance with contractual terms and achieving business plan commitments.
- You will work on your own project and collaborate closely with the other site's commercial team to look for efficiencies.

About You
- Experience in a Quantity Surveying role, supporting senior QS professionals.
- General knowledge of monitoring cost performance of projects and contract administration.
- Evidence of working in a team and building effective relationships with customers and stakeholders.
- Experience in a civil engineering / highways maintenance environment, self-delivery is an advantage.
- NEC experience is a must.
